An abridgement of the authors': Reforming pensions : principles and policy choices. Includes bibliographical references (p. 215-222) and index. The backdrop -- The basic economics of pensions -- Pensions and labor markets -- Finance and funding -- Redistribution and risk sharing -- Gender and family -- Implementing pensions -- International diversity and change since 1950 -- Pension systems in different countries -- Close focus : pension reform in chile and china -- Principles and lessons for policy. |
